DAILY LESSON PLAN YEAR 1

ENGLISH
DATE : 2/1/2018
YEAR : 1 BERLIAN
DURATION : 1010 - 1110 60 Minutes
THEME : World of self, family and friends
TOPIC : Topic 1 At School
FOCUS SKILLS : : Speaking
CONTENT STANDARD / : 1.1 Recognise and reproduce target language sounds
COMPLIMENTARY CS 3.1 Recognise words in linear and non-linear texts by using knowledge of sounds of
letters
LEARNING STANDARD / : 1.1.1 Recognise and reproduce with support a limited range of high frequency target
COMPLIMENTARY LS language phonemes
3.1.1 Identify and recognise the shapes of the letters in the alphabet
LEARNING OBJECTIVES : By the end of the lesson, the pupils will be able to:
1) recognise at least 6 letters correctly by listening and colouring the correct
phonemes (s, a, t, p).
2) sound out at least 3 phonemes with correctly with support.
CROSS CURRICULAR : Constructivism
ELEMENTS
ACTIVITIES
i. PRE-LESSON : Pupils are guided to sing the Phonics song with gestures while doing a recap on s, a, t
and p
ii. LESSON DEVELOPMENT : TRANSITION PROGRAMME
1. Pupils listen to the sounds and watch the gestures.
2. Pupils are guided to listen and say out the words by using the suitable blending
technique.
3. Pupils listen to sounds and colour the correct phoneme.
iii. POST-LESSON : Pupils match the pictures to the correct words using the matching mat.
